The tax problem resolution market is BOOMING. As more and more taxpayers have gone from W-2 to 1099, more and more taxpayers have fallen behind on their taxes. Statistics show that approximately 14 million taxpayers are in collections with IRS as we speak--those folks could really use some professional help right about now.

There are several reasons why the tax "offseason," can be just as busy and profitable as Tax Season. There are an ever-increasing number of people with complex tax debt. In addition, approximately 50% of our workforce is self-employed (not by choice). The bigger the problems, the more likely folks are going to procrastinate. Their procrastination is "Offseason," work for you!
